Output f85e609ffc0a8cba26ca99f54e349a2c7a9de302c5a2291619c9d727ec1c6d68:0

value
522889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e8744ef9b829b87509c7500e7e2151bdb041735 OP_EQUAL
address
35w343QoZDBXrfijnXb6ehAqg1zmtrzV3r
transaction
f85e609ffc0a8cba26ca99f54e349a2c7a9de302c5a2291619c9d727ec1c6d68
spent
true